Paper Hockey

Paper Hockey is a turn-based game played on a 11x11 grid.

The game starts with a puck at the center of the grid, and the goal of the game is to take the puck into your opponent's net.

Goals are at the north and south boundaries of the grid (see the picture below).


Rules:

  • Each turn, a player can throw the puck in one of 8 directions (N, S, W, E and diagonals)
  • The puck can't travel twice on the same segment - once the ice is crushed you can't go back.
  • Shooting the puck into a visited node or a wall results in a bounce, which allows the active player to make another move.
  • You have at most 2 seconds to send your move. Timing out means losing the game.
  • A game is won by scoring a goal or forcing the other player into checkmate (see Checkmate section).

Checkmate example

In this game, player one just moved into a wall and has to play again (bouncing). Because all the segments out of the current node are crushed, player one cannot issue a valid move and loses by checkmate.

Getting started

To play the game, you must connect to localhost:8023. The protocol is text-based - you can even play from telnet!

Once connected, the first thing you'll receive is:

What's your name?

You should reply with your team name, and receive this confirmation:

Welcome, Bob you're player 0!

Once both players have entered their name, they will receive information about the game:

  • position of the ball
  • where is your goal
  • {player_name} is active player [only if it's your turn]
Game is on - 1
ball is at (5, 5) - 3
your goal is north - 5
Bob is active player - 7

Moves

When you're the active player, you can send one of the following moves:

north
north east
east
south east
south
south west
west
north west

Once a valid move is issued, Player 1 (aka Bob) will receive:

south
Bob did go south - 9

and P2 (aka Malory) will receive:

Bob did go south - 8
Malory is active player - 10

Invalid move

If Malory tries to go north now, she'll receive "invalid move".

Bob won't be notified of invalid moves.

Bob did go south - 8
Malory is active player - 10
invalid move - 11

If you send an action when it's not your turn, you'll receive:

ignoring action south - 20
